Original 1929 University of Illinois Commencement Week booklet, issued for ceremonies held June 6–12, 1929 in Urbana, Illinois.
Bound in embossed tan leather with cord tie binding, measuring approx 4.5\" x 6\", printed by The Print Shop, Madison, Wisconsin.
Includes:
Full Program of Commencement Week (Senior Ball, Alumni events, Baccalaureate, President’s Reception, etc.)
Complete listings of graduates from every college and school — including Liberal Arts & Sciences, Commerce and Business Administration, Law, Engineering, Agriculture, Education, Library Science, Music, and Journalism.
Committee and class officer rosters for the Senior Class.
Photographs of key campus buildings, the Agricultural Building, Uni Hall, Mathematics Building, and the Senior Memorial (Alma Mater).
Portrait of University President David Kinley.
Early appearance of the Alma Mater sculpture, just before its 1929 installation.

?? Historical Note
President David Kinley (1861–1944) served as university president from 1920–1930 and was a nationally known economist and educator who helped shape public-university policy during the interwar period. His signature portrait and inclusion mark this as one of the final commencement booklets under his administration.
